Output e223a152438523cd7c54d77596093f4e0431c657dcc2fc7187ed735cb4f9ace4:0

value
8445625794
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c1ce82e9dbd227c3faf4b73e01704fd43e11a82e69bed3f0fd3d1da2c40c63c4
address
tb1pc88g96wm6gnu87h5kulqzuz06slpr2pwdxld8u8a85w693qvv0zqud3lfu
transaction
e223a152438523cd7c54d77596093f4e0431c657dcc2fc7187ed735cb4f9ace4
confirmations
76589
spent
true